Q: Is 77,530,888 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 77,530,888 is not a prime number.

Why is 77,530,888 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 77530888 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 251 502 1,004 2,008 38,611 77,222 154,444 308,888 9,691,361 19,382,722 38,765,444 and 77,530,888, with no remainder.

Since 77,530,888 cannot be divided by just 1 and 77,530,888, it is not a prime number.
